State Contractor Licensing: Hawaii requires contractor licensing through DCCA Hawaii DCCA licenses contractors—verify at cca.hawaii.gov/pvl. License classification must match work type.
Extremely High Costs: Hawaii has the highest construction costs in the US Materials ship from mainland, labor is expensive. Reddit notes costs are 50-100% above mainland. Low bids are major red flags.
Salt Air Corrosion: Salt air destroys materials not designed for coastal exposure Salt corrodes metal rapidly. Reddit strongly recommends marine-grade hardware, stainless steel, and corrosion-resistant materials.
Humidity & Moisture: Tropical humidity creates constant moisture challenges Humidity is relentless. Reddit emphasizes ventilation, moisture-resistant materials, and mold prevention strategies.
Lava Zones (Big Island): Big Island has active lava zones affecting insurance Lava zones affect property values and insurance availability. Reddit recommends understanding zone ratings.
